No BS summary

Principal-level product strategy owner for Commercial / Medical Affairs in life sciences, with 10+ years hands-on segment experience. Must understand Commercial / Medical Affairs workflows, market dynamics, customers, and be comfortable prototyping with AI/low-code tools. US-based role.

What you'll do

  • Taken ownership of and refined Komodo’s Commercial / Medical Affairs segment strategy, ensuring a clear view of where to invest to in product development to drive growth, retention, and account penetration
  • Shipped 3-5 solutions — apps, agents, data products, skill suites, etc. — that are live, generating revenue, and solving real problems for Commercial / Medical Affairs customers
  • Established yourself as the go-to internal and external expert at the intersection of Komodo's portfolio and the Commercial / Medical Affairs market — including representing Komodo at industry forums and conferences.
  • Own segment strategy for Commercial / Medical Affairs with a P&L mindset toward where to invest to drive growth, retention, and account penetration - both in the near- and mid-term
  • Conduct ongoing product reviews tracking Commercial / Medical Affairs performance by product, competitive dynamics, and portfolio gaps
  • Consistently engage externally with customers, partners, and industry forums to understand market trends, buyer/user needs, and the competitive landscape
  • Prototype new product concepts using AI and low-code approaches, then build PRDs and partner with PM and Engineering to iterate and ship
  • Lead market entry for new Commercial / Medical Affairs products at early adopters: serve as early internal user; develop initial value proposition; collaborate with Sales on early pitches; collaborate with our forward deployed team to support early customer implementations; and feed structured insights back to Product, Engineering, Marketing, and Sales teams
  • Bring Product vision and expertise to key, high-value RWE/HEOR deals
  • Serve as Komodo's Commercial / Medical Affairs subject matter expert at conferences and events

What they require

  • 10+ years of deep, hands-on experience in Commercial / Medical Affairs – leading teams within life sciences organizations, running studies as a consultant, or leading the segment within a healthcare data/analytics company.
  • You’ve lived the workflow, not just studied it from the outside.
  • Expert-level understanding of the Commercial / Medical Affairs segment: use cases, buyer and user personas, competitive dynamics, and where the market is heading
  • Analytical rigor: fluency in both qualitative market intelligence and quantitative data — including internal signals (revenue, pipeline, product usage, win/loss) and external signals (market trends, competitor moves, investor reports) — with a demonstrated ability to build well-structured, evidence-based strategies from both
  • Exceptional communication and influencing: the ability to translate complex ideas into crisp written, visual, and oral narratives for diverse audiences including customers, executives, and cross-functional teams
  • Track record of operating as an integrative, cross-functional leader (e.g., across Product, Sales, and Marketing functions)
  • Experience using AI coding / coworking tools to build something — software, prototypes, workflows, agents.
  • No engineering background required, but genuine curiosity and comfort with building is essential
  • Preferred: Prior product management experience or hands-on track record shipping products
  • We expect you to integrate AI into your daily work – from summarizing documents to automating workflows and uncovering insights.
